Output 51e2090cd21ced4f74da04f6ef3f58722567a0d3b90109040d1790e20060bc74:1

value
14038324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0c506c596f94bc6ac34d32eedf22e5628e69280 OP_EQUAL
address
3LitW5jRtYjpiFJ4hFbako5Sw4ewt8uYxf
transaction
51e2090cd21ced4f74da04f6ef3f58722567a0d3b90109040d1790e20060bc74
spent
true